ATHENS — Oconee County girl’s soccer is blazing hot! The team is 5-0 heading into tonight’s matchup against the Lakeside Vikings. The team is being led by Sara Walsh, the 16-year-old we met earlier this year who is scheduled for a kidney transplant this summer. Walsh scored a goal in Tuesday’s game and is leading the team into tonight’s 6:00 pm game.
